В современном интернет-пространстве безопасность передаваемой информации является одной из основных задач. Каждый пользователь сталкивается с веб-ресурсами, использующими протоколы передачи данных, такие как HTTP и HTTPS. Хотя оба протокола служат для передачи данных между клиентом и сервером, они имеют ключевые отличия, которые значимо влияют на уровень безопасности.
HTTP (Hypertext Transfer Protocol) — это стандартный протокол, используемый для передачи данных в интернете. Однако он не обеспечивает шифрование, что делает информацию, передаваемую через этот протокол, уязвимой для перехвата и злоумышленников. В то время как HTTPS (Hypertext Transfer Protocol Secure) добавляет уровень защиты, используя SSL/TLS шифрование. Это позволяет безопасно передавать данные и защищает пользователей от различных видов атак.
Понимание различий между HTTP и HTTPS критически важно как для разработчиков, так и для пользователей. С учетом возрастания числа кибератак, использование защищенного протокола становится необходимостью. В данной статье мы подробно рассмотрим, чем отличаются эти два протокола, и почему переход на HTTPS становится все более важным для всех веб-ресурсов.
Интернет – это огромная сеть, где каждый день происходит обмен огромным объемом данных. Важной частью этого обмена являются протоколы, которые управляют тем, как данные передаются между компьютерами. Наиболее распространенными протоколами являются HTTP и HTTPS. Но чем они отличаются? В этой статье мы подробно рассмотрим различия между HTTP и HTTPS, их преимущества и недостатки, а также роль, которую они играют в обеспечении безопасности пользователей в сети.
HTTP (HyperText Transfer Protocol) является основным протоколом для передачи данных в интернете. Он был разработан в начале 90-х годов и с тех пор стал стандартом для загрузки веб-страниц. Основная функция HTTP – обеспечить возможность передачи гипертекстовых документов, таких как HTML, между клиентом (например, браузером) и сервером.
HTTPS (HyperText Transfer Protocol Secure) — это расширение HTTP, которое добавляет уровень безопасности с помощью шифрования. Основная цель HTTPS – защитить данные, передаваемые между браузером пользователя и сервером, от перехвата и подделки. HTTPS использует протоколы SSL (Secure Sockets Layer) или TLS (Transport Layer Security) для обеспечения шифрования.
Одним из основных различий между HTTP и HTTPS является уровень безопасности. Когда вы используете HTTP, все данные передаются обычным текстом, что делает их уязвимыми к атакам, таким как "Человек посередине" (Man-in-the-Middle). Это означает, что злоумышленник может перехватить данные, такие как пароли или номера кредитных карт, передаваемые между вами и сервером.
С другой стороны, HTTPS шифрует данные, что делает их нечитаемыми для злоумышленников. Это шифрование обеспечивает защиту конфиденциальной информации, такой как личные данные пользователей, что делает HTTPS более безопасным выбором для любого веб-сайта, который собирает или передает конфиденциальные данные.
Помимо обеспечения безопасности, использование HTTPS также имеет некоторые дополнительные преимущества. Одним из них является повышение доверия пользователей. Когда пользователи видят, что веб-сайт использует HTTPS, они более склонны доверять этому сайту и чувствовать себя в безопасности при вводе своих персональных данных.
Еще одним преимуществом использования HTTPS является то, что поисковые системы, такие как Google, отдают предпочтение сайтам с HTTPS в своих результатах поиска. Это означает, что переход на HTTPS может положительно повлиять на SEO вашего веб-сайта и улучшить его видимость в интернете.
Являясь расширением HTTP, HTTPS требует настройки SSL-сертификата на сервере. SSL-сертификат подтверждает, что сервер является тем, за кого себя выдает, и что данные, передаваемые между вами и сервером, действительно защищены. Получение SSL-сертификата включает в себя дополнительную работу и может потребовать финансовых затрат, но эти усилия и инвестиции оправданы в свете преимуществ, которые они приносят.
Важным аспектом перехода на HTTPS является то, что это не просто изменение протокола, но и необходимость обновления всех внутренних и внешних ссылок на вашем сайте. Если вы используете абсолютные ссылки на свои страницы, их нужно будет изменить, чтобы они начинались с https:// вместо http://. Также стоит наладить выполнение редиректов с HTTP на HTTPS, чтобы избежать потери трафика.
Важно отметить, что переход на HTTPS не является панацеей от всех проблем безопасности. Например, защитить веб-сайт от атак DDoS, SQL-инъекций и других уязвимостей всё равно придется с помощью дополнительных мер безопасности. Тем не менее, HTTPS – это важный этап на пути обеспечения безопасности вашего веб-сайта и ваших пользователей.
Существуют и некоторые недостатки, связанные с использованием HTTPS. Например, шифрование данных может немного замедлить загрузку страниц, так как требует дополнительного времени для установления защищённого соединения. Однако с развитием технологий и аппаратного обеспечения это замедление стало минимальным и практически незаметным для пользователей.
Таким образом, можно сделать вывод, что разница между HTTP и HTTPS очень значительна. HTTPS предлагает уровень безопасности, который недоступен в HTTP, и это особенно важно в современном интерне-те, где безопасность и конфиденциальность данных имеют критическое значение. Переход на HTTPS не только защищает ваших пользователей, но и может улучшить позиции вашего сайта в поисковых системах, повысив его доверие и репутацию.
Работа с интернет-технологиями подразумевает необходимость следить за последние тенденциями и обновлениями. Поэтому, если у вас еще нет HTTPS на вашем веб-сайте, стоит подумать о его внедрении. Безопасность данных – это не просто модная тенденция, а необходимость для любого веб-ресурса, который серьезно относится к своим пользователям.
На сегодняшний день многие хостинг-провайдеры предлагают бесплатные SSL-сертификаты, такие как Let's Encrypt, что делает переход на HTTPS еще более доступным. Кроме того, многие инструменты для управления контентом, такие как WordPress, предоставляют простые способы установки и настройки SSL-сертификатов, что значительно упрощает процесс для веб-мастеров.
Не стоит забывать о том, что пользователи также должны быть осведомлены о различиях между HTTP и HTTPS. Чем больше людей понимает, что означает значок замка в адресной строке и насколько важна безопасность их данных, тем быстрее растет потребность в безопасных веб-ресурсах. Важно обучать пользователей осознанному поведению в интернете и объяснять им, как распознавать безопасные сайты.
В заключение, HTTP и HTTPS – это разные протоколы, каждый из которых играет свою роль в интернета. HTTP по-прежнему используется и будет использоваться для множества задач, однако HTTPS становится стандартом для всех веб-сайтов, особенно тех, которые взаимодействуют с конфиденциальной информацией пользователей. Понимание этих двух протоколов и их различий – важный шаг в развитии технологий и обеспечении безопасности в интернет-пространстве.
Безопасность — это не большое, а малое дело, которое требует внимания к деталям.
Эдвард Сноуден
Параметр | HTTP | HTTPS |
---|---|---|
Безопасность | Не защищённый | Защищённый |
Шифрование | Нет шифрования | Использует SSL/TLS |
Порт | 80 | 443 |
Скорость | Чаще быстрее | Иногда медленнее из-за шифрования |
Использование | Основной для незащищённых сайтов | Рекомендуется для всех сайтов, особенно для передачи чувствительной информации |
SEO | Не влияет на рейтинг | Лучше ухудшает SEO |
Отсутствие шифрования данных
Основная проблема HTTP заключается в отсутствии шифрования данных, что делает передачу информации уязвимой к перехвату третьими лицами. Это может привести к утечке конфиденциальных данных, таких как пароли, кредитные карты или личная информация пользователей.
Недостаточная безопасность соединения
HTTP не обеспечивает аутентификацию сервера и клиента, что делает его уязвимым к атакам типа "man-in-the-middle". Злоумышленники могут подделать запросы или ответы сервера, вмешиваться в передачу данных и даже изменять их содержимое без ведома пользователей.
Негативное влияние на рейтинг в поисковых системах
Сайты, работающие на протоколе HTTP, могут испытывать проблемы с рейтингом в поисковых системах из-за недостаточной безопасности передаваемых данных. Поскольку защита информации пользователей становится все более важной, поисковики придает большее значение HTTPS сайтам, что может негативно сказаться на посещаемости и позициях в выдаче.
HTTP передает данные в открытом формате, в то время как HTTPS использует шифрование для защиты конфиденциальной информации.
HTTP использует порт 80, а HTTPS использует порт 443 для передачи данных.
При попытке доступа к HTTPS сайту через HTTP браузер автоматически перенаправляет пользователя на защищенное соединение HTTPS.
Материал подготовлен командой seo-kompaniya.ru
Читать ещё
Главное в тренде
SEO оптимизация интернет-магазина
Как качественно настроить сео интернет-магазина? Какие основные этапы поисковой оптимизации необходимо соблюдать для роста трафика из поиска?Наши услуги
SEO аудит сайта Продвижение сайта по позициям SMM продвижение Настройка контекстной рекламы SEO оптимизация